Nicole Gordon – Couples Cooking
Nicole Gordon is a licensed marriage and family therapist, practicing in South Florida, both in-office and in clients’ homes. Nicole grew up in Miami, and has traveled many places internationally to learn about different cultures and history, particularly about many different culinary techniques and practices. In her spare time, Nicole can usually be found at the dog park with her Lhasa Apso or in the kitchen trying to make something new. With her passion for cooking and for helping people, she moves clients into the kitchen to utilize the way in which people orient to food and its preparation in therapeutic ways. Nicole has been in the mental health field for over ten years, received her Masters in Marriage and Family Therapy from Nova Southeastern University, and is a PhD Candidate in the same program, focusing her dissertation, appropriately, on Cooking Therapy with Couples. Nicole has experience in treating a variety of issues includi ng grief, infidelity, divorce, autism, self esteem, depression, anxiety, and more.


Scott Roseff, MD is board certified in reproductive endocrinology and infertility. He was the founder of and former director of reproductive medicine at a major medical center in NJ and practiced there for 17 years before relocating to South Florida 10 years ago. He holds memberships in numerous prestigious technical societies including the American Society for Reproductive Medicine and The Society for Reproductive Endocrinology and Infertility. He is an elected Fellow and Diplomate of The American Congress of Obstetricians and Gynecologists. Dr. Roseff is also an ad-hoc reviewer for the journal “Fertility and Sterility”, an official journal of the American Society for Reproductive Medicine.

Marni Feuerman is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ker and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ist currently in private practice in Boca Raton, Florida. She has a Master of Social Work degree from Barry University in Miami and is currently pursuing her Doctorate in Clinical Psychology from California Southern University. Marni specializes in couples therapy and relationship issues. She has clinical training in Emotionally Focused Couples Therapy and Discernment Counseling for mixed-agenda couples. Marni is the current marriage expert and content writer for the website About.com. She also writes for several other websites, including YourTango.com, Dr. Oz’s Sharecare.com and PsychCentral.com. Marni is a frequently quoted expert in the media on issues related to marriage, relationships, couples and love.
